diff --git a/src/client/plugin/desktop-notifications/meson.build b/src/client/plugin/desktop-notifications/meson.build index 501d3042..d09e723b 100644 --- a/src/client/plugin/desktop-notifications/meson.build +++ b/src/client/plugin/desktop-notifications/meson.build @@ -13,7 +13,8 @@ shared_module( vala_args: geary_vala_args, c_args: plugin_c_args, install: true, - install_dir: plugin_dest + install_dir: plugin_dest, + install_rpath: client_lib_dir, ) i18n.merge_file( diff --git a/src/client/plugin/email-templates/meson.build b/src/client/plugin/email-templates/meson.build index 56ef251f..835eb72c 100644 --- a/src/client/plugin/email-templates/meson.build +++ b/src/client/plugin/email-templates/meson.build @@ -13,7 +13,8 @@ shared_module( vala_args: geary_vala_args, c_args: plugin_c_args, install: true, - install_dir: plugin_dest + install_dir: plugin_dest, + install_rpath: client_lib_dir, ) i18n.merge_file( diff --git a/src/client/plugin/folder-highlight/meson.build b/src/client/plugin/folder-highlight/meson.build index 0a5fdeb1..2abd611d 100644 --- a/src/client/plugin/folder-highlight/meson.build +++ b/src/client/plugin/folder-highlight/meson.build @@ -13,7 +13,8 @@ shared_module( vala_args: geary_vala_args, c_args: plugin_c_args, install: true, - install_dir: plugin_dest + install_dir: plugin_dest, + install_rpath: client_lib_dir, ) i18n.merge_file( diff --git a/src/client/plugin/messaging-menu/meson.build b/src/client/plugin/messaging-menu/meson.build index 8a14b7c6..7b3bb0ab 100644 --- a/src/client/plugin/messaging-menu/meson.build +++ b/src/client/plugin/messaging-menu/meson.build @@ -32,7 +32,8 @@ if libmessagingmenu_dep.found() vala_args: geary_vala_args, c_args: plugin_c_args, install: true, - install_dir: plugin_dest + install_dir: plugin_dest, + install_rpath: client_lib_dir, ) i18n.merge_file( diff --git a/src/client/plugin/notification-badge/meson.build b/src/client/plugin/notification-badge/meson.build index 98dca2e8..008c4a85 100644 --- a/src/client/plugin/notification-badge/meson.build +++ b/src/client/plugin/notification-badge/meson.build @@ -16,7 +16,8 @@ shared_module( vala_args: geary_vala_args, c_args: plugin_c_args, install: true, - install_dir: plugin_dest + install_dir: plugin_dest, + install_rpath: client_lib_dir, ) i18n.merge_file( diff --git a/src/client/plugin/sent-sound/meson.build b/src/client/plugin/sent-sound/meson.build index ba627228..7228ecc2 100644 --- a/src/client/plugin/sent-sound/meson.build +++ b/src/client/plugin/sent-sound/meson.build @@ -16,7 +16,8 @@ shared_module( vala_args: geary_vala_args, c_args: plugin_c_args, install: true, - install_dir: plugin_dest + install_dir: plugin_dest, + install_rpath: client_lib_dir, ) i18n.merge_file( diff --git a/src/client/plugin/special-folders/meson.build b/src/client/plugin/special-folders/meson.build index f6d1d522..347d40ea 100644 --- a/src/client/plugin/special-folders/meson.build +++ b/src/client/plugin/special-folders/meson.build @@ -13,7 +13,8 @@ shared_module( vala_args: geary_vala_args, c_args: plugin_c_args, install: true, - install_dir: plugin_dest + install_dir: plugin_dest, + install_rpath: client_lib_dir, ) i18n.merge_file(